Right, on the GH games the notes which you cannot HO/PO have black rims. On RB the notes you cannot HO/PO are larger. It's harder to tell them apart when star power is activated, but they are different there, too.

On medium you should be able to strum just about every note.

I've got two recommendations for Chad for medium difficulty:

1) Try doing some "alt-strumming" (alternately pressing the strum button up and down) on passages which you have a sequence of the same note. It's not necessary for passing (or even 5-starring) medium, but it will help you later.

2) Get used to moving your hand from what I call "first position" (index finger on green and pinky on blue) to "second position". (index on red, pinky on orange). Again, not strictly necessary for medium, but useful. You can practice this when you have a green note followed by a red. Play the green note normally with your index finger, then shift your hand slightly and play the red note with your index finger, too.
